How are you checking the categories?
In FP 2003 View Reports Workflow Categories

When you categorize a page FP adds a xhtml header tag and script to the head section of the page

Stephan,
I can get them all to categorize if I edit the site live
(instead of editing and then publishing to the site).

I've seen that happen when I add a title to a PDF that's already been
published - the only way to fix it is to edit the site live and add the
title there.
